Hoolet
What it is
Hoolet is a prototype OWL-DL reasoner that translates an ontology into first-order axioms and sends them to a first-order prover for consistency checking. Its implementation uses the WonderWeb OWL API for parsing, Vampire for reasoning, and TPTP as the communication format; it was also extended to translate SWRL rules.

How you’d use it
On Linux, unpack the prototype, run hooletGUI, load an OWL ontology URL and optionally a rules URL, activate selected rules, and issue queries from the Query panel. Inputs are expected as OWL RDF/XML and rules as RDF using the proposed SWRL schema.

Pitfalls & lessons
The authors explicitly call the translation naive, say it is highly unlikely to scale, and position Hoolet for small illustrative examples rather than effective reasoning. The bundled prototype is Linux-only, loading an ontology clears current rules, rule class atoms must be named classes, and Hoolet’s performance should not be treated as evidence about Vampire’s general performance.
Verdict
Useful as a small-scale demonstrator of OWL/SWRL translation into first-order theorem proving, not as a scalable production reasoner.
